Advance Tickets

A single ticket for one journey leaving at a specific date and time.

The rule is: the sooner you book the cheaper they are. Usually the cheapest, but least flexible.

Off-Peak & Super Off-Peak Tickets

Offering greater flexibility than Advances, Off-Peak tickets offer travel during less busy times of day trading off more flexibility in the Off-Peak windows but for still discounted fares.

Anytime Tickets

Anytime tickets are fully flexible allowing travel at any time of the day. Brilliant if you don’t want the pressure of clock watching, returning when you want

Station Facilities and Amenities

For those embarking on their journey from High Street station, there are several amenities to ensure a smooth experience. The ticket office operates extensive hours, from 05:50 to 23:30 on weekdays and Saturdays, and 08:10 to 23:15 on Sundays. While the absence of ticket machines might be a slight hitch, you can collect tickets bought online directly from the ticket office. Accessibility support includes help from staff present throughout the same operational hours. However, note that the station doesn’t offer step-free access nor ramp support for train access, so passengers requiring assistance should contact the support helpline in advance for help.

Accessibility and Passenger Assistance

High Street station faces some challenges with accessibility features. Classified as a Category C station, there’s no step-free access, which may pose issues for those with mobility issues. Passengers who need additional support should take advantage of the Passenger Assist service, available for booking up to two hours before your journey. Station staff are ready to help and can be contacted directly at the help points or ticket office.

Station Facilities at Dumbreck

While Dumbreck Station welcomes travelers with open arms, it's essential to be prepared for a modest array of amenities. The station does not feature a ticket office, which makes the available ticket machines crucial for collecting pre-purchased tickets or purchasing fresh ones on the spot. These machines are user-friendly and accessible for all passengers, including those requiring step-free access. Rest assured, Dumbreck is equipped with an induction loop and smartcard validators to facilitate your travel.

Adventurers will appreciate that while there are no waiting lounges, the station offers a seating area to relax while waiting for your train. However, facilities such as toilets, refreshment options, and bike hire services are absent, so it might be wise to plan accordingly.
